fbpx
Animalia / Arthropoda / Malacostraca / Decapoda / Aristeidae / Aristeus
Predation Carnivory
Animalia / Mollusca / Cephalopoda / Oegopsida / Ommastrephidae / Todarodes

Cases

Load More